About Pathavalasa

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Pathavalasa village is 586026. Pathavalasa village is located in K Kotapadu mandal of Visakhapatnam district in Andhra Pradesh, India. It is situated 7km away from sub-district headquarter K.kotapadu (tehsildar office) and 48km away from district headquarter Visakhapatnam. As per 2009 stats, Pathavalasa village is also a gram panchayat.

The total geographical area of village is 306 hectares. Pathavalasa has a total population of 1,064 peoples, out of which male population is 540 while female population is 524. Literacy rate of pathavalasa village is 50.75% out of which 62.04% males and 39.12% females are literate. There are about 283 houses in pathavalasa village. Pincode of pathavalasa village locality is 531034.

Visakhapatnam is nearest town to pathavalasa for all major economic activities, which is approximately 48km away.
